Mobile Workforce Scheduling Software: Features & Advantages
Modern mobile workforce operations demand optimized scheduling – and that's where tailored scheduling software shines. These platforms offer a wealth of functionalities designed to increase productivity and customer satisfaction. Important features typically include automated dispatching, plumbing dispatch software real-time location monitoring , drag-and-drop calendar viewing , and integrated messaging tools. Furthermore , many include mobile apps for service personnel , allowing them to get work orders, change status, and document data on the spot. The advantages are substantial: reduced travel expenses, improved asset utilization, limited errors , and greater aggregate performance . Essentially, adopting field service scheduling software is a valuable step towards upgrading your business .
